HMI’s Rights. (a) HMI will have the right (but not the obligation) to initiate an Infringement Action anywhere in the world against any Third Party as to any Competing Infringement of any [***] at its cost and expense; provided, that (i) HMI will keep NVS reasonably informed about any such Infringement Action, (ii) NVS will provide reasonable cooperation to HMI in connection with such Infringement Action, including by promptly supplying or executing all papers and instruments, or requiring its employees to supply or execute such papers and instruments, as may be necessary for purposes of initiating and pursuing such Infringement Action, at HMI’s cost and expense, (iii) HMI will not take any position with respect to, or settle, such Infringement Action in any way that would adversely affect the scope, validity, or enforceability of any [***] without the prior written consent of NVS, such consent not to be unreasonably withheld, conditioned, or delayed, and (iv) if HMI determines not to institute an Infringement Action with respect to a Competing Infringement, or determines to cease to pursue any such Infringement Action, then, in each case, it will promptly inform NVS of the same and NVS may have the right to pursue such Infringement Action.
